Every people have their own unique stories in their life which is absolutely different from others. We have different experience in our life. So I'm quite surprised that people nowadays are so easily to judge other people by only what they see in the social media platform. 

In my opinion, every people in social media will only share and show what they want people to see about their life. If i want people see "this" so i will only post "this" and i wont post "that" and so do you. You will only post what do you want people to see, rite? So no wonder that if you only saw about happiness in their life because they only posting about what makes them happy. And because they don't want people to see their sorrow, they won't post about how breaking is heart, or how bad their day today because their boss mad at them. So if you see his or her post about their current life such as showing a new bag, phone, house, car or anything that she/he bought or his/her traveling experienced, or what they eat in the fancy restaurant or the job that she/he got, so what? We have no right to judge them "Ooh they are bragging now" or Ooh how pity they are so they need to show to the world that they have it" or something like that. Because we don't know their whole world! But if you are really happy being a judge (I know i can't forbid you to be one because it's kinda like our natural instinct as human), ooh please don't post your judgemental words in the social media UNLESS you are certain that you never do the same things, bragging about your life, though maybe it's not about MATERIAL thing but who knows, people see it as "bragging your life" as well. 

Do you think that posting your beautiful, happy family isn't seen as bragging to people who don't have luxury of such perfection like yours? Things currently happening in your life that you post to show other people no matter what it is, may count as bragging, IF YOU PUT IT THAT WAY. Why don't you see it as they want to show other people about WHAT MAKES THEM HAPPY? Just like what you want to tell people with your post in social media.

So, don't forget to be happy with your own version of happiness and feel free to share it. 
And please refrain yourself to post judgemental words if what makes them happy is different than yours :)
